Please go to http://usgwarchives.net/la/sttammany/obits/dateobits/2013/st1307.htm and click to view list of photos. ========== Clyde Rickey Tilley, 59, died at his home in Covington, LA on July 24, 2013 after an intense battle with cancer. He was born in Alexandria, LA on September 17, 1953, the only son of Clyde “Buddy” Tilley and “Es” Atkinson Tilley of Alexandria. He was a graduate of Bolton High School, attended Southeastern University at Lafayette, LA and St. Petersburg College in St. Petersburg, FL where he majored in creative writing. He worked at the St. Petersburg, FL Marina for a number of years and while living in St. Petersburg was instrumental in founding Hannah’s Homeless, a shelter to assist the homeless population of the area. He was an author, guitar picker and had recently established an inspirational web site, Facebook/ Recovery, to send daily messages of encouragement to those recovering from addiction. He was known for his talent as a cook and was an avid reader of science fiction. He is survived by one sister, Kathy G. Tilley of Natchez, MS and Gulf Breeze, Fl and two aunts, Mrs. Ruby Tilley Monroe of Shreveport, La and Mrs. Jean Speer, and her husband John, of Hot Springs Village, AK. His ashes will be scattered from a sailboat at sea. In lieu of flowers, memorials may be made in his honor to: Hannah’s Homeless at www.hannahshomeless.org. ===================
